The sign-up process for is really quite long: it took me about 20 to thirty minutes to complete, so make sure you reserve time to complete it since if you stop mid-sign-up and exit your browser, it will not conserve your answers and you’ll need to start all over again.

You can sign up by clicking any of the green buttons on the homepage, which will ask you to validate what type of therapy you have an interest in, though as we stated prior to if you click anything besides talk therapy, you’ll be rerouted to among’s other sites.
From there, you’ll be asked a series of concerns in a consumption survey about your gender identity, age, sexual orientation, and relationship status. It is worth keeping in mind that the business supplies a variety of choices for describing your gender identity and sexual orientation. You can choose from woman, guy, non-binary, transfeminine, transmasculine, agender, “I don’t know”, “Choose not to state”, and “Other” for explaining your gender identity. Relatively, provides users more options to describe their gender than Talkspace does. In detailing your sexual orientation, you are given the alternatives of straight, gay, lesbian, bi/pan, “Choose not to say”, “Questioning”, queer, asexual, “I don’t know”, and “Other”.

During the consumption questionnaire, if you answer that your religion is Christian, you will be asked “Would you like to be matched with a Christian-based therapist?”

Nevertheless, if you address that you relate to a various faith, you won’t get asked if you wish to match with a therapist of that faith. I attempted addressing this concern 3 times, each time stating I was from a different religion, and never got that very same follow-up. That being said, the only options for “Which religion do you identify with?” include Christianity, Judaism, Islam, and Other.

After the questions about your identity and religious affiliation, you will be asked to complete questions about your psychological health history, such as whether you have actually ever been in therapy prior to and what led you to treatment today. Options for what led you to therapy include “I’ve been feeling depressed”, “My mood is disrupting my job/school performance”, “I am mourning”, and 10 other options. You will be asked what your expectations are from your therapist, such as a therapist who listens, explores your past, teaches your new skills, designates you homework, and more.

The platform will ask you to rank your existing physical health and consuming habits from good, fair, and bad.

It will ask you if you are experiencing overwhelming unhappiness or depression. Following this, there will be a few concerns from the Client Health Questionnaire, or the PHQ-9, an assessment utilized to evaluate for depression.

If you are currently utilized as well as how often you consume alcohol, you will be asked. When the last time you thought about suicide was– if ever, other screening concerns towards the end include if you have any issues with intimacy and.

In addition to anxiety, it asks you if you are experiencing anxiety or panic attacks, or persistent discomfort. Other market concerns consist of how you would rate your existing monetary status on the exact same good, fair, or poor scale.

I found the concerns to be a bit random as I went through the questionnaire. Next, will ask you to rate your sleeping practices and respond to if you are comfortable with your identity.

How much does counseling expense?

Conventional in person therapy commonly sets you back $150-250 per session, while online treatment varies from $60-90 weekly (billed every 4 weeks). With in person therapy, you’re paying for one real-time counseling session each week, and you typically can not contact your specialist in between sessions. With online therapy, you’re spending for one online treatment session per week, along with the capability to message your specialist 24/7. With BetterHelp treatment, therapists usually check their messages once or twice a day.
